Debugging the kernel
/proc/kmsg is a file that stores all the kernel messages from the very first seconds of the boot process. A copy of that file isn't always needed to fix a bug, but since I've explained how to get one I don't even remember how many times, I'll write here the needed steps:
1. open a terminal on your phone
2. run the following commands:
- su
- cat /proc/kmsg > /sdcard/kernel_log
3. the log will be stored in kernel_log.

Governor
pixel_smurfutil
smurfutil_flex
Pixel_smurfutil is a mix between Pixel 3 schedutil, helix_schedutil and electrotuil. Next frequency selection is load based and in suspend all cores are forced to a lower frequency max level. Three big cores are forced to operate at minimum frequency (825 MHz). One big core could clock up to general maximum, 1300 MHz). In normal operation load based frequency selection is used.

What's the difference between the usual schedutil and helix_schedutil?
NateDev said:
What's the difference between the usual schedutil and helix_schedutil?
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
The difference between all 4 governors is the way how next frequency is selected. Electroutil and pwrutilx are ramping flatter if the device is suspended. Electroutil is cutting max frequency if device is suspended. Check governor settings, you could adjust it. Helix is ramping frequencies different based on load scenario. Lower load, flatter ramp. More battery friendly in my opinion.
For future versions i'll mix a new governor that combines these concepts.
Gesendet von meinem BKL-L04 mit Tapatalk
